WEEK 11 DEFENSIVE STATS
Chiefs - 2002 Defensive Stats
Total yards: #32 (390.5 yards/game) vs Run: #24 (129.2) vs Pass: #31 (261.9) PPG: #28 (24.9) Take Aways: (1.93 per game) Chiefs - 2003 Defensive Stats Total yards: #29 (356.7 yards/game) vs Run: #30 (146.5) vs Pass: #20 (210.2) PPG: #19 (20.8) Take Aways: (2.31 per game) Chiefs - 2004 Defensive Stats Total yards: #30 (377.3 yards/game) vs Run: #12 (114.6) vs Pass: #32 (262.7) PPG: #29 (27.2) Take Aways: (1.31 per game) Chiefs - 2005 (thru week 11) Total yards: #25 (331.0 yards/game) (-37 avg/game better since week 5) vs Run: #5 (89.6) (-5 avg/game better since week 5) vs Pass: #27 (252.9) (-32 avg/game better since week 5) PPG: #21 (21.4) (-1 avg/game better since week 5) Take Aways: (1.90 per game) Discuss... |
